Victory for the Proteas in that match would put them level with 
Australia on 125 ratings points. However, South Africa would be just 
ahead of their hosts by a fraction of a ratings point (124.85 points 
compared to Australia's 124.64). India will retain their thir place in 
that case. 

Australia though can regain the number one position immediately as they 
take on New Zealand for five ODIs, just two days after the Perth match. 
Whichever side leads the ODI Championship table on April 1 will collect 
$175,000 with the runners-up pocketing $75,000. The same is true of the 
Test Championship with the top team walking away with $350,000.
